Table 3.
Cancer, leukaemia, ALL, and non-leukaemia cancer hazard ratios in the pooled dataset using a time-varying coefficient for birthweight across two time periods (age at diagnosis <3 vs. ≥3 years old) adjusting for sex and gestational age
| Diagnosed <3 years old | Diagnosed ≥3 years old | Comparison of HRs between time periods, P-value | ||||||
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Diagnosis | Birthweight | Cases | HR | 95% CI | Cases | HR | 95% CI | |
| Cancer | ≥4.0 kg | 182 | 0.84 | 0.56, 1.27 | 195 | 1.60 | 1.13, 2.26 | 0.018 |
| Top 10% | 0.80 | 0.46, 1.39 | 1.64 | 1.10, 2.44 | 0.037 | |||
| Continuous | 1.08 | 0.82, 1.42 | 1.44 | 1.11, 1.88 | 0.099 | |||
| Leukaemia | ≥4.0 kg | 59 | 1.08 | 0.55, 2.13 | 56 | 1.56 | 0.84, 2.88 | 0.43 |
| Top 10% | 1.08 | 0.46, 2.54 | 1.55 | 0.72, 3.30 | 0.54 | |||
| Continuous | 1.29 | 0.79, 2.11 | 1.57 | 0.96, 2.57 | 0.56 | |||
| ALL | ≥4.0 kg | 49 | 1.02 | 0.48, 2.15 | 49 | 1.49 | 0.77, 2.88 | 0.45 |
| Top 10% | 1.07 | 0.42, 2.73 | 1.28 | 0.54, 3.03 | 0.79 | |||
| Continuous | 1.23 | 0.72, 2.11 | 1.34 | 0.78, 2.30 | 0.81 | |||
| Non-leukaemia | ≥4.0 kg | 123 | 0.75 | 0.45, 1.24 | 139 | 1.62 | 1.06, 2.46 | 0.020 |
| Top 10% | 0.67 | 0.33, 1.38 | 1.68 | 1.05, 2.68 | 0.035 | |||
| Continuous | 0.99 | 0.71, 1.38 | 1.39 | 1.02, 1.91 | 0.10 | |||
Model 2: Stratified Cox proportional hazard regression with a time-varying coefficient for birthweight based on an indicator function for time defined at the age of diagnosis cut-point adjusted for gestational age and sex of the child.
